Artificial intelligence-Artificial intelligence (AI) is experiencing a wave of innovation, with new and groundbreaking merchandise emerging regularly. One current instance is ‘non-public AI,’ created with the aid of an entrepreneur named Suman Kanuganti. This AI device ambitions to allow customers to create virtual twins of themselves.
The company the back non-public AI, based totally in NY, has developed the device with the use of its own non-public language model gadget in preference to relying on fashions from larger tech groups. In contrast to normal AI chatbots, private AI is not skilled in net statistics but in facts furnished by each individual consumer. This lets customers have conversations with a chatbot that has a character and reviews just like their very own. It’s like speaking to oneself!
Training the chatbot to be a person’s twin is a time-consuming technique, and the AI chatbot constantly learns from the person, with the enterprise assuring that everyone shared statistics stay personal and owned using the consumer.
Private AI additionally makes use of a ‘memory Stack’ for training, that's a virtual vault storing the person’s existing reviews and normal conversations. This enables the AI to grow to be extra like the person and evolve over time.
Suman Kanuganti expressed non-public AI’s dedication to constructing ethical and independent AI that enhances human lives. As opposed to relying on existing models, the corporation has evolved its own non-public language version known as GGT-P, which learns from the consumer’s particular know-how, reminiscences, and experiences to create an AI that sincerely represents the person.
How to Grow a Virtual Twin with AI Equipment
Growing a virtual twin the use of AI equipment typically includes a mixture of information collection, modeling, and device-gaining knowledge of strategies. Here's a standard evaluation of the stairs concerned in developing a digital twin with AI:
Records collection: gather applicable statistics approximately the bodily object or device which you need to create a virtual twin. This will include sensor facts, historical statistics, layout specifications, and different applicable records. The data series system may additionally contain IoT gadgets, sensors, or manual information access.
Records preprocessing: clean and preprocess the amassed statistics to get rid of noise, cope with missing values, and make sure consistency. This step is important for making sure the accuracy and exceptional of the digital dual.
Version improvement: build a mathematical or computational version that represents the conduct and characteristics of the bodily item or system. This model can be based totally on physics-primarily based equations, statistical methods, or system learning algorithms, relying on the complexity of the machine and the to-be-had data.
Device studying and AI strategies: educate the version on the use of machine mastering and AI techniques to research styles and relationships from the accumulated records. This step may additionally involve tasks including regression, classification, clustering, or time collection analysis, depending on the specific requirements of the digital twin.
Integration and simulation: combine the trained version right into a simulation environment that mimics the behavior of the physical object or device. These simulation surroundings permit you to interact with and manipulate the digital dual.
Calibration and validation: Validate the accuracy and reliability of the virtual twin by comparing its outputs with real-world statistics. This step helps make certain that the virtual dual appropriately represents the behavior of the physical object or device.
Continuous tracking and updating: as soon as the digital twin is created, it may be constantly monitored using actual-time records from sensors or other resources. The virtual twin can be up to date and refined through the years to enhance its accuracy and predictive competencies.
It's critical to word that developing a virtual twin is a complex and iterative manner that requires area information, information availability, and technical capabilities in AI and modeling. Depending on the unique software, the system might also range, and additional steps may be required.
